#21f006 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#21f006 is composed of 12.9% red, 94.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 113.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#21f006 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ff0c with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#21f006 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#21f006 has RGB values of R:33, G:240,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 2224134.

Shades and Tints of #21f006
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a00 is the darkest color, while #f7fff6 is the lightest one.
